Research and Professional Activity
Coordinator of SAFESIDE - Roadside Safety (2007-2011) and IRUMS - Safer Urban Road Infrastructures (2005-2010), both financed by Fundação para a Ciência e a Tecnologia.Coordinator of LNEC´s participation in the EU´s ERA-NET ROAD program's project RISMET - Road Infrastructure Safety Management Evaluation Tools. (2009-2010).Coordinator of LNEC´s participation in the EU´s VI Framework Research Program STREPs ´RIPCORD-Road infrastructure safety protection-Core research and development for road safety in Europe; increasing safety and reliability of secondary roads for a sustainable surface transport´ (2004-2008), ´IN-SAFETY - Infrastructure and Safety´ (2004-2008) and IRP ´SafetyNet - The European Road Safety Observatory´ (2004-2009). Coordinator of LNEC´s participation in EU´s IV Framework Research Program research projects ´SAFESTAR - Safety Standards for Road Design and Redesign´ (1996-1999) and ´GADGET - Guarding Automobile Drivers through Guidance, Education and Technology (1997 to 1999). Portuguese representative at the Management Committee of COST-329 (´Models for Traffic and Road Safety Developments and Interventions´) action, from 1996 to 1999. Participated in LNEC´s team for the EU´s research project ´SUNFLOWER+6´, from 2003 to 2005.Participated in the COST-331 (´Requirements for road markings´) action, from 1996 to 1999.
Scientific Orientation
He was responsible for Road Safety related disciplines in the Transportation MSc course of Instituto Superior Técnico (2001-2007), the Road Engineering MSc course of the Universities of Coimbra and Minho (2001-2007) and the Urban Engineering MSc course of the University of Coimbra (1993-2000). Coordinator of a one week course on accident investigation and reconstruction, for the Associação Portuguesa de Seguradores (Portuguese Insurers Association), in 2005. Responsible for classes on simulation and reconstruction of road accidents, in the ´Road Accident Week´ of the Judge and Attorney General High Course at the Ministry of Justice´s Centro de Estudos Judiciários (1993-2008). Responsible for classes on ´Infrastructure corrective actions´ and ´Urban road design´ of the course ´Safety and urban road management´ promoted by the Portuguese Association for Road Accident Prevention (PRP) in 1999 and 2000. Supervisor of six PhD's dissertations at the Instituto Superior Técnico and Faculdade de Ciências of the University of Lisboa, University of Coimbra and the University of Porto. Supervisor of seven pré-Bologna MSc dissertations, in several universities.
